Directional Terms

Inferior (caudal)

Away from the head end or toward the lower part of a structure or the body; below

Lateral

Away from the midline of the body; on the outer side of

Deep (internal)

Away from the body surface; more internal

Distal

Farther from the origin of a body part or the point of attachment of a limb to the body trunk

Superficial (external)

Toward or at the body surface

Ventral (anterior)

Toward or at the front of the body; in front of

Medial

Toward or at the midline of the body; on the inner side of

Proximal

Close to the origin of the body part or the point of attachment of a limb to the body trunk

Dorsal (posterior)

Toward or at the backside of the body; behind

Superior (cranial or cephalad)

Toward the head end or upper part of a structure or the the body; above
